A517 Grade E is a high-strength quenched and tempered alloy steel plate used in demanding structural applications requiring excellent toughness and weldability. It is commonly specified for heavy machinery, pressure vessels, and components that must withstand extreme loads and harsh environments. Through controlled heat treatment, the steel develops a refined microstructure that provides good fracture resistance and reliable performance even at low temperatures. Its ability to maintain strength and ductility under stress makes it a preferred choice in construction, energy, and manufacturing industries where safety and durability are essential.

Chemical Composition  

MATERIAL C Mn Si P≤ S≤
A517GRE 0.10-0.22 0.35-0.78 0.08-0.45 0.035 0.035

 

Mechanical Property

MATERIAL Tensile Strength(MPa) Yield Strength(MPa) MIN % Elongation MIN
A517GRE 729-930 620 14

processing

Melting and Casting

The process begins with melting carefully selected raw materials in a controlled furnace environment. The chemical composition is closely monitored to achieve the required alloy balance that defines the grade. Once fully melted and homogenized, the steel is cast into ingots or continuous cast slabs, forming the initial semi-finished shape.

Hot Rolling

The slabs are reheated to a precise temperature and then subjected to hot rolling. Multiple passes through rolling mills gradually reduce thickness and shape the material into plates. This stage introduces significant plastic deformation, which refines the grain structure and contributes to the steel's high strength and toughness.

Heat Treatment

After rolling, the plates undergo quenching, where rapid cooling transforms the microstructure into a hard, strong state. This is followed by tempering at a lower temperature to improve toughness, reduce internal stresses, and stabilize the material properties. Strict control of time and temperature ensures consistent performance across the entire plate.

Finishing and Inspection

The final steps include straightening, cleaning, and surface treatment as needed. Comprehensive inspection, such as ultrasonic testing, is performed to detect any internal or surface defects. Only plates that meet the required standards proceed to packaging and shipment.

What are the main chemical components of A517GrE?

The main chemical components of A517GrE include carbon (C), manganese (Mn), silicon (Si), chromium (Cr), molybdenum (Mo), and small amounts of phosphorus (P) and sulfur (S), which ensure its mechanical properties.

 

What is the thickness range of A517GrE plates commonly supplied?

The common thickness range of A517GrE plates is 6-200 mm. Custom thicknesses can be supplied based on specific project requirements, subject to manufacturing feasibility.

 

Is A517GrE weldable?

 Yes, A517GrE has good weldability. Proper preheating and post-weld heat treatment (PWHT) are recommended to avoid weld cracks and ensure the integrity of the welded joint.

Can A517GrE be used in low-temperature environments?

Yes, A517GrE is suitable for low-temperature environments due to its good low-temperature impact toughness. It can work stably at temperatures as low as -20°C (-4°F) without brittle failure.

 

What machining processes is A517GrE suitable for?

A517GrE is suitable for various machining processes, including turning, milling, drilling, and cutting. Proper cutting tools and parameters are recommended to ensure machining efficiency and surface quality.

 

What is the recommended preheating temperature for A517GrE welding?

The recommended preheating temperature for A517GrE welding is 150-200°C (302-392°F). This reduces the cooling rate of the weld zone and prevents hydrogen-induced cracking.
